Frames damaged or cracked

If a uPVC frame is damaged, it can allow water and air to enter the home. It can also allow warm air to seep into the house and cold air to escape, leading to more expensive energy bills. In certain cases the need for a window replacement will be needed to restore the strength of the frame. A reputable uPVC firm can usually resolve the issue with a quick, affordable solution.

The ideal time to locate an expert to repair cracks in windows is right after the incident, since this prevents moisture from entering the home and causing further damage. If the glass in the double-pane windows is not shattered, then it could be repaired with some form of putty or adhesive. If the glass is cracked the glass must be replaced as soon as is possible.

It's important to regularly inspect your windows for signs of warping, cracks and discoloration. If you notice any of these problems make contact with an uPVC repair specialist immediately. They will help you determine if your window requires repairs or replacement, and advise the best course of action to take.

Leaking Sealed Units

The glass panes in modern double-glazed windows are put together to make one unit, which is known as an IGU (insulated glazing unit). There will be condensation between window panes if the seal breaks. The condensation is a sign that the gas that is inert between the panes has evaporated and warm air from your home is finding its way in. The window will be functional, but it won't function as well as it did prior to the seal was broken. This kind of problem is not fixable, and the IGU needs to be replaced.

This is not a DIY project and should be left to professionals who have previous experience working with IGUs. They can replace the IGU without removing the entire window. If you're in a determined streak and some time to spare, it is possible to remove the IGU from the frame by yourself however, be aware that it is an extremely difficult task.

You can try to remove the IGU by using a sharp knife along the edge of each pane, gently cutting into the sealant, and breaking the glass off from the spacer bar. Then, use paint thinners or a different solvent to get rid of the remaining sealant and glue. Be cautious as this could be very hazardous when done incorrectly and could result in scratching or cracking the glass.

A leaky seal could be a problem, particularly in the months leading to winter. It will make your heating system work harder than it should and add to the cost of energy. It's also a safety issue because it allows your home's infrared heating to escape, and may even allow an intrusion.
